Who Clogged the Afghan Refugee Pipeline? Stephen Miller.

The airlift of endangered Afghan refugees from Taliban-controlled Kabul is hampered by a lengthy and convoluted visa process, which had a backlog of 20,000 applicants before the fall of the corrupt Karzai government. In 2018 the Pentagon urged the Trump administration to expedite Special Immigrant Visas for Afghan nationals who had assisted US and NATO forces, but this was denied.

Olivia Troye, homeland security and counterterrorism advisor to former Vice President Mike Pence, says all efforts to fast-track Afghan visas were sabotaged by Stephen Miller, racist and Islamophobe-In-Residence at the Trump White House. This was confirmed by Elizabeth Neumann, a former senior DNS official. Matt Zeller, Afghanistan combat veteran and former CIA officer, says Stephen Miller “should be held accountable for war crimes” for his refugee visa obstruction.

Trump Travel Ban Protects US From Terrorist Grannies

The U.S. Supreme Court, now with Trump appointee Neil Gorsuch on board, has ruled that a modified version of Donald Trump’s travel ban can go into effect for 90 days, as of yesterday evening. Travelers from six majority-muslim countries, none of whose citizens have committed terrorist acts on United States soil, must now document “bona fide relationships” with U.S. persons, companies, or institutions in order to travel to the USA.

The Trump administration has issued directives defining “bona fide relationships,” and the weirdest ones involve families of of U.S. citizens and legal residents. Some relatives may travel to the USA: Spouses, children and stepchildren, siblings and stepsiblings, parents and step-parents, father-in-laws and mother-in-laws, fiancées and fiancés. Who may not travel: Grandparents, grandchildren, sister-in-laws and brother-in-laws, uncles and aunts, nieces and nephews, or cousins.

This is a pretty strange definition of “family” by any standards. Remember, little Donnie Trump grew up across the street from his own immigrant grandmother in Queens, NY.

New Crime: Flying While Bilingual

While his Southwest Airlines flight was at the gate at LAX two weeks ago, a college student called his uncle on his mobile phone and was promptly hauled off the plane. Why? He was speaking to his uncle in Arabic.

UC Berkeley senior Khairuldeen Makhzoomi was on a flight to Oakland on April 6 when he called his uncle in Baghdad to tell him about an event he attended in LA. A frightened passenger spoke with flight attendants, and Mr. Makhzoomi was escorted off the plane to a public area in the terminal, where security officers searched him. FBI agents arrived, spoke with him, determined he was no threat, and let him fly back home on Delta.

Mr. Makhzoomi has lived in the US since 2010. He is the son of an Iraqi diplomat who was imprisoned and killed by Saddam Hussein. Imagine what he must make of this LAX experience. He is the sixth Arab American thrown off a flight at a US airport in the past four months. How many Islamophobes have been removed from planes? Zero.
